About Sutton Coldfield Town Hall

Sutton Coldfield Town Hall is a Grade A locally listed theatre venue with a seating capacity of c.400, with regal charm. We are a charitable trust run entertainment venue and community hub, with a focus on combining great shows and experiences with funding the legacy and longevity of the building and its history

Main Duties and Responsibilities

  • To ensure the smooth running of shows and events, from a technical / stage aspect, working closely with the event organisers / touring company in the lead up to and on the day of the event.
  • Liaise with the touring company prior to an event as the venue’s technical point of contact to ensure technical rider has been obtained, any set up / rigging has happened and any additional technical staffing required has been arranged.
  • Ensure any external contractors working on site within a relevance to your remit are working within the buildings Health & Safety policies and good working practices.
  • Assist with room set up for other events being held at the venue where technical involvement is required.
  • To maintain the upkeep of our technical equipment, to include, but not limited to, lamp cleaning, identifying and coordinating any repairs as and when needed and sourcing new equipment when required.
  • To act as a key holder, opening, closing and securing the building as required.
